Do you ever feel alone in your homeschooling journey, like no one really understands your struggles? Are you wrestling with your kids being different because they are homeschooled?
Do you question if you are doing enough in your homeschool? Or worry if your kids will be equipped for life beyond homeschool including college, careers and adulthood?

We have found ourselves asking these same questions. We're Tori and John, homeschool parents of 4 kids. After lots of prayer, persistence, encouragement from other families on the same path, and taking it one step at a time we are continuing to learn and grow in the homeschooling journey.

Pull up a chair, grab some coffee, and join us as we dive into discussions related to topics ranging from having peace and overcoming obstacles in homeschooling, the value of fulfilling your God-given calling as a homeschooler. We believe a great source of encouragement comes from building a tribe of people who support and encourage your homeschooling adventure. We want to offer you insight on how to build that community. Along the way we will throw in some good fun and encouragement.
